Phio Pharmaceuticals (PHIO) recently released its the previous quarter earnings results, reporting no revenue for the quarter and a GAAP net loss per share of -0.253. As a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on developing RNA interference (RNAi) therapies for oncology and rare disease indications, the absence of product revenue is consistent with the firm’s current operational phase, as none of its pipeline candidates have received regulatory approval for commercial sale to date. Management Commentary

During the the previous quarter earnings call, PHIO’s leadership team focused primarily on operational progress across its pipeline, rather than core financial metrics, given the company’s development stage. Management noted that the quarterly spending levels aligned fully with the firm’s previously announced budget, with more than 70% of quarterly operating costs allocated to advancing its lead immuno-oncology candidate through mid-stage clinical trials. The team also highlighted positive enrollment trends for ongoing trials, noting that patient recruitment is running at the higher end of internal projections, which could potentially support an earlier readout of initial safety and efficacy data than some market observers had previously modeled. Management also confirmed that the company’s current cash position is sufficient to cover planned operating expenses for the foreseeable future, with no immediate plans to pursue additional public financing that would dilute existing shareholders. Forward Guidance

As is standard for pre-revenue biotech firms, Phio Pharmaceuticals did not provide formal financial guidance related to revenue or earnings for future periods. Instead, the company shared a set of operational milestones it is targeting in the upcoming months, including the release of initial interim data from its lead candidate’s mid-stage trial, submission of a new investigational new drug (IND) application for a second pipeline asset focused on a rare dermatological condition, and ongoing discussions with potential strategic partners to support late-stage development and commercialization of its lead program. Management emphasized that all projected milestones are subject to regulatory feedback, clinical trial enrollment rates, and unforeseen operational risks, and that timelines may shift as a result. Market Reaction

Following the release of PHIO’s the previous quarter results, trading activity in the stock was largely in line with average recent volumes, with no significant sharp price movement in the immediate sessions after the announcement. Analysts covering the company noted that the reported loss per share was roughly in line with consensus estimates, and the lack of revenue had been fully priced in by market participants, leading to the muted reaction. Most analysts covering Phio Pharmaceuticals note that future performance of PHIO shares will likely be driven primarily by clinical trial results and regulatory updates, rather than quarterly financial results, as long as operating spending remains within expected ranges. Some analysts have noted that positive interim data from the lead candidate’s trial could potentially drive increased investor interest in the stock, while delays to key milestones may introduce additional volatility.
